I plan to build a Daphne/Mame cab and will be installing both a repro DL scoreboard AND a repro SA annunciator. Will both of these board work with Daphne and SA? I have the repro scoreboard working fine via a PCI parallel port interface card, but do not know how to connect up the SA annunciator board for it to work in Daphne. Much appreciate any help.

It would be technically possible (but not immediate) to connect a conversion annunciator board or skill level buttons to an interface like Ultimarc's I-PAC in order to have the skill selection buttons working with Daphne. However external LEDs/lamps for difficulty level are not handled in any way by Daphne at the moment, so there will be no way to drive them directly. The only possibility would be to use the three keyboard LEDs, as far as I know.

Thanks for the info. So what does the Daphne command line option "-use_annunciator" do then? The Daphne wiki entry states "Use this when using a real Space Ace scoreboard with the annunciator board attached. Space Ace only." - I was hoping that this meant that using a scoreboard and annunciator display board would be possible with Daphne with skill level selection made via Daphne rather than the original cabs hardwired skill select switches.

Yes, I guess you are right and I'm wrong. I didn't know of this option (never used it), but looks like it has been implemented. With that option and with scoreboard and annunciator panel connected to the parallel port, it should work. See also here.
This only applies to the annunciator leds/lamps of course, not the difficulty selection buttons. For those what said in the previous message stays valid.

I'm good with software implementation (Daphne) for selecting the skill level (my cab will be fairly generic and so I do not want SA skill buttons on it anyway). So, I suppose my question comes down to what hardware is needed to achieve this. I have both a repro scoreboard and a repro SA annunciator board, but how does one connect these simultaneously to a PC with Daphne? Does the scoreboard connect via a parallel port cable and the annunciator piggy back off of the scoreboard (via what cable and connections though)? Or do both boards connect directly to the PC - thereby requiring a PC with two parallel ports?

They need to connect on the same ribbon cable, ending in a single PC parallel port. The ribbon cable will have two connectors in parallel, one going to the scoreboard and the other going to the annunciator panel in parallel.
